The crisp, fresh air of the forest, the panorama that opens up imposingly to 4000m and fills the eyes with majesty, the contagious energy that is released after exertion: taking the children for a walk at the foot of Monte Rosa recharges and relaxes at the same time. Thus, almost without realizing it, one feels incredibly light and happy.

We have thought and created many proposals for holidays with your children. We assure you unforgettable experiences and adventurous undertakings, all obviously family-sized! Below you will find some recommended itineraries to share the beauty of the mountain with your children, without too much effort.

Pian Villy, a walk… to give space to the imagination!
Pian Villy smells of flowering meadow grass, the wood of statues, the resin of the woods. A small ring that you can cover on foot, with a trekking stroller, following an easy path that starts and ends in Champoluc. Along the itinerary you will find characteristic wooden works by local artists and legends scattered along the way, which allow you to discover the characters that imagination and popular tradition have handed down over the centuries.
You can walk it at all hours of the day and the comfortable wooden tables will be your allies for a family picnic!

The Ru Courtod - the irrigation channel between lush fir trees, pastures and tunnels
Imagine a long, flat walk with a view of Monte Rosa, what more could you ask for? The Ru Courtaud is the irrigation channel which, starting from the source above Saint-Jacques, reaches the Col de Joux, in a succession of unique panoramas. The beauty of this excursion is that it has several starting points and can also be covered for short stretches (the total length is in fact 24 km and without major gradients). Along the path you will find alpine pastures where you can eat a delicious polenta and where you can taste the cheeses produced there, and the suggestive galleries that allow you to glimpse the Brusson area with its magnificent lake. The darkness and coolness of the tunnels make the route exciting and adventurous for children, especially if they are involved as little explorers, with a flashlight or headlamp.

The Mascognaz waterfall - a postcard from Champoluc
Just behind the Champoluc Tourism Office, the path starts which in 15 minutes reaches the panoramic point of the Mascognaz waterfall: the stream descends from the village of the same name and takes a nice thunderous dip, a show for all children! Illuminated even in the evening, the water becomes frozen in winter when temperatures drop below zero. The first section can also be traveled with a stroller and allows you to get to the first waterfalls, but if you want to have another view, the path that starts in the woods will lead you to another panoramic point. This time, however, the path becomes very narrow and uphill!
